В этой статье блога мы рассмотрим концепцию связанных табличных формул и обсудим различные методы использования их возможностей. Мы предоставим примеры кода для иллюстрации каждого метода, что позволит вам легко понять концепции. К концу этой статьи вы получите четкое представление о связанных табличных формулах и их практическом применении.
Содержание:
-
Что такое формулы связанных таблиц?
-
Метод 1: суммирование связанных значений
-
Метод 2: подсчет связанных записей
-
Метод 3: поиск максимальных или минимальных значений
-
Метод 4: расчет средних значений
-
Метод 5: фильтрация данных на основе связанных критериев
-
Метод 6: объединение связанных текстовых значений
-
Метод 7: агрегирование связанных данных с помощью группировки
-
Метод 8: выполнение сложных вычислений с использованием связанных таблиц
-
Вывод
-
Что такое формулы связанных таблиц?
Формулы связанных таблиц позволяют выполнять вычисления между таблицами в базе данных или электронной таблице. Они устанавливают связи между таблицами на основе общих полей и позволяют получать доступ к данным из связанных записей и манипулировать ими. -
Метод 1: суммирование связанных значений
Пример кода:=SUM(RELATEDTABLE(Sales[Amount]))Объяснение: Эта формула суммирует столбец «Сумма» из таблицы «Продажи», связанный с текущей записью.
-
Метод 2: подсчет связанных записей
Пример кода:=COUNTROWS(RELATEDTABLE(Orders))Пояснение: Эта формула подсчитывает количество записей в таблице «Заказы», связанных с текущей записью.
-
Метод 3: поиск максимальных или минимальных значений
Пример кода:=MAXX(RELATEDTABLE(Products), Products[UnitPrice])Объяснение: Эта формула находит максимальную цену за единицу продукции из таблицы «Продукты», которая связана с текущей записью.
-
Метод 4: вычисление средних значений
Пример кода:=AVERAGEX(RELATEDTABLE(Sales), Sales[Quantity])Пояснение. Эта формула рассчитывает средний объем продаж на основе таблицы «Продажи», связанной с текущей записью.
-
Метод 5: фильтрация данных на основе связанных критериев
Пример кода:=FILTER(RELATEDTABLE(Orders), Orders[Status] = "Completed")Объяснение: Эта формула фильтрует таблицу «Заказы», связанную с текущей записью, на основе значения поля «Статус».
-
Метод 6: объединение связанных текстовых значений
Пример кода:=CONCATENATEX(RELATEDTABLE(Products), Products[ProductName], ", ")Объяснение: Эта формула объединяет значения «ProductName» из таблицы «Products», связанной с текущей записью, разделенные запятыми.
-
Метод 7: агрегирование связанных данных с помощью группировки
Пример кода:=SUMMARIZE(RELATEDTABLE(Orders), Orders[CustomerID], "Total Sales", SUM(Orders[Amount]))Объяснение: Эта формула группирует таблицу «Заказы», связанную с текущей записью, по «CustomerID» и рассчитывает общий объем продаж для каждого клиента.
-
Метод 8: выполнение сложных вычислений со связанными таблицами
Пример кода:=CALCULATE(SUM(Sales[Amount]), FILTER(RELATEDTABLE(Products), Products[Category] = "Electronics"))Пояснение: Эта формула вычисляет сумму «Сумма» из таблицы «Продажи», отфильтрованную на основе связанных записей из таблицы «Продукты» с категорией «Электроника».
В этой статье мы рассмотрели несколько методов использования возможностей связанных формул таблиц. Эти формулы открывают целый мир возможностей для анализа и манипулирования данными. Используя эти методы, вы можете получить ценную информацию и принять обоснованные решения на основе взаимосвязей между вашими данными. Начните включать формулы связанных таблиц в свои рабочие процессы и раскройте весь потенциал своей базы данных или электронной таблицы.